    INTERIM ORDER OF THE BOARD
    (by Mr.
    Zeitlin):
    Motion for Interlocutory Appeal filed by Complainant
    is granted.
    Complainant shall have 14 days from the date
    of this Order to file its appeal.
    Respondent shall have
    7
    days to respond after Complainant files its appeal with the
    Board.
    Complainant shall then have
    7 days to reply
    to
    Respondent’ s answer.
    Motion for a Continuance is granted until two weeks
    after the Board’s decision on the Interlocutory Appeal.
    IT IS SO ORDERED.
